Meaning of Homali
The meaning of Homali is not verified in any major linguistic or etymological sources. Extensive research across languages including Sanskrit, Hindi, Persian, Arabic, Pashto, Balochi, Sindhi, and regional dialects did not yield a documented meaning. The original article suggested a connection to ‘Jasamine’ (likely a variant of Jasmine), implying a floral association, but this appears speculative. Without reliable references, the meaning remains uncertain, and it may be a modern invention or localized adaptation. In such cases, names often derive from phonetic appeal rather than traditional roots.

Origin & Cultural Significance
The origin of Homali is unknown, as it does not appear in historical records or standard naming databases. It is primarily used in Hindu contexts, but this may reflect contemporary naming trends rather than ancient tradition. The name might be a creative variation of similar-sounding names like Himali (from Sanskrit for ‘snowy’) or Hamsa (Sanskrit for ‘swan’), but no direct lineage is established. Its usage seems modern, possibly emerging from regional influences or personal preferences, without ties to specific cultural or linguistic heritage.
